他们的工作

Greentown Labs 是一家领先的气候科技孵化器,专注于促进电力、建筑、交通、农业和制造等各个领域的创新。该组织提供共享的原型设施,而不是开发自己的技术,这使得早期气候科技初创企业能够在支持性环境中蓬勃发展。Greentown Labs 拥有10万平方英尺的实验室空间,提供湿实验室、机械车间、电子实验室和环境测试室等基本资源,以满足其成员初创企业的独特需求(来源: climatebase.org)。孵化器还为450多名企业家提供办公空间和可容纳500人的活动空间,确保初创企业能够获得成功所需的工具和设施(来源: greentownlabs.com)。Greentown Labs 建立了一个策划的生态系统,促进合作、指导和投资者介绍,这对硬件聚焦的初创企业的成长至关重要。

项目与业绩

虽然 Greentown Labs 并不直接执行项目,但它在帮助其成员初创企业实现重大里程碑方面发挥了关键作用。显著的影响包括原始租户 Promethean Power Systems 的成功,该公司开发了离网制冷解决方案,受益于印度超过17,000名农村农民,在孵化器进行原型开发后(来源: news.mit.edu)。到2018年,成员初创企业共创造了超过1,000个就业机会,并筹集了3.4亿美元,展示了孵化器在培育创新方面的有效性。根据最近的统计,Greentown Labs 已支持超过360家初创企业,筹集超过15亿美元的资金,显示出其对气候科技领域的重大影响(来源: climatebase.org)。孵化器的持续努力专注于接待当前的早期公司,并扩大其设施以满足对气候科技创新日益增长的需求。

近期发展

在过去两年中,Greentown Labs 并未宣布任何重大合同、收购或融资轮,重点仍然放在历史里程碑上,例如2018年全球清洁技术创新中心的开幕和2021年工具车间的建立(来源: greentownlabs.com)。该组织继续保持北美最大的气候科技孵化器的地位,成员初创企业共筹集了15亿美元,这突显了 Greentown Labs 在气候科技领域的持续相关性和影响力(来源: climatebase.org)。尽管最近没有记录具体的奖项或认证,但孵化器作为气候科技创新领导者的声誉依然强大。

Job Description

Greentown Labs is seeking a hands-on, relationship-driven Manager, Partnerships to manage a portfolio of partner accounts in Houston. Reporting to the Director, Partnerships, this role owns account delivery and renewals across your book, with support from the broader Partnerships team.

You will step into an active set of partner accounts and be accountable for retention, activation, engagement delivery, the value of your portfolio, and the number of partners you serve. This is an account-management role, distinct from new business development, which sits with our BD team.

This is a role for a dependable account manager who is energized by being in the room with partners, who keeps the details tight, and who thrives in a fast-paced, mission-driven environment.

What you'll do

Account Portfolio & Delivery

  • Own day-to-day delivery and management across your portfolio of partner accounts
  • Deliver on partner engagement and account activation with a focus on customer delight
  • Manage onboarding and renewals with support from the broader team
  • Help grow the value and partner count of your book over time

Partner Relationships

  • Onboard, steward, and retain partners, and be the dependable point of contact for your accounts
  • Represent Greentown to partners and across the Houston campus

Qualifications

  • Experience: 4-6+ years of progressive experience in partnership, account, or member-relationship management, with delivery and retention in your name
  • Account Management: Track record managing partner or client accounts day to day, including renewals, with support from a broader team
  • Education: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ience; concentrations in business, sustainability, or a related field a plus
  • Communication: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to represent the organization to partners and stakeholders
  • Mission: Real climate and energy interest with substance, able to name programs, startups, or technologies rather than express general enthusiasm
  • Organization: Strong account and project-management discipline; fluent with CRM tools like Salesforce or comparable, plus Google Workspace and Microsoft Office Suite
  • In-Person: Comfort with a hybrid on-site presence at our Houston location, three days a week and more as needed for partner engagements, with travel to Somerville as the work requires
  • Preferred: Familiarity with the climatetech, energy, or built-environment ecosystem; experience managing enterprise or member accounts
